LGC is a global leader in life science tools, partnering with customers to provide innovative solutions for some of the world's most complex challenges. The company specializes in diagnostics and genomics, offering products and services that improve the safety of food, medicines, and the environment. LGC's expertise extends to nucleic acid therapeutics, biosearch technologies, and reference standards, supporting accurate diagnostics and safety compliance. Their commitment to science and public health is evident in their response to global pandemics and contribution to conservation efforts using genotyping technologies. By collaborating with end-user labs, biopharma, and academic institutions, LGC continues to advance precision medicine and enhance global health standards through research, proficiency testing, and the development of new technologies.

• Identify and develop new sales opportunities across biopharma, diagnostics manufacturers, CROs, and academic institutions. • Expand existing customer relationships by uncovering additional applications for TNAC reagents (e.g., assay development, QC, vaccine R&D). • Drive revenue growth through proactive outreach including targeted account strategies, cold calls, email campaigns, and virtual engagement. • Map key accounts involved in immunoassay development, infectious disease testing, and biologics development. • Deliver technical presentations and product demonstrations focused on TNAC reagents, including antigens, antibodies, and viral proteins. • Understand and address customer challenges related to assay sensitivity/specificity, reagent consistency, and supply chain reliability. • Provide consultative support for reagent selection in applications such as: ELISA and lateral flow assay development, neutralization and binding assays, vaccine and therapeutic research, and diagnostic kit manufacturing. • Build and maintain strong customer relationships to ensure retention and long-term partnership growth. • Collaborate cross-functionally with product management, R&D, and operations to align on customer needs, custom projects, and supply requirements. • Track and report sales activities, pipeline status, customer feedback, and market intelligence in CRM systems. • Develop deep expertise in infectious disease biomarkers and viral proteins, immunoassay workflows and reagent requirements, and biopharma and diagnostic manufacturing processes. • Analyze market opportunities and identify high-growth segments (e.g., emerging infectious diseases, multiplex diagnostics, vaccine programs).
• Bachelor’s degree in a biological field (e.g., Immunology, Virology, Molecular Biology, Biochemistry); Master’s or Ph.D. preferred • Hands-on experience with Immunoassays (e.g., ELISA, lateral flow) or protein based workflows. • Prior experience in technical sales, account management, or customer-facing scientific support preferred. • Strong presentation and communication skills, with the ability to convey technical concepts to a broad audience. • Strong computer skills required, with a working knowledge of Microsoft Office suite of products, particularly Word, Excel, and PowerPoint. • Self-motivated, goal-oriented, and comfortable working in a fast-paced, results-driven environment. • Ability to work remotely and manage multiple priorities effectively.
